On behalf of the Editorial board of the Latin American Journal of Aquatic Mammals (LAJAM), led by our Editor-in-Chief Dr. Miriam Marmontiel and our Managing Editor Dr. Daniel González-Socoloske, I would like to announce the publication of a Special Issue for the 20th anniversary of the Journal.

As many of you may already know, LAJAM is an open access peer-reviewed scientific electronic journal that publishes articles on research, management and conservation biology of aquatic mammals in Latin America. 

To celebrate our 20-year milestone, a new special issue of the journal was conceived with the idea of publishing a series of review papers focusing on major topics related to the aquatic mammals of Latin America. A call for proposals was sent to aquatic mammal scientists that work in the area. We received over 30 proposals, which were carefully reviewed and the authors of 15 of these proposals  were  invited  to  submit  reviews. The  Editor-in-Chief along  with  four  associate  editors  (Nataly  Castelblanco-Martinez,  Daniel  Gonzalez-Socoloske,  Carolina  Loch, and Aldo S. Pacheco) were selected as guest editors for this special issue. In the end, 10 review articles passed the peer-review process, and these are:
